云服务器搭建网站,云服务器搭建网站教程linux
随着互联网的发展,越来越多的个人和企业开始意识到,拥有一个网站不仅仅是展示自己的窗口,更是提升品牌影响力、拓展市场的关键工具。而在这个过程中,云服务器的选择与使用,成为了搭建网站的核心环节之一。今天,我们就来探讨如何通过云服务器搭建网站,助力个人与企业在数字化时代快速崛起。
什么是云服务器?
云服务器是指基于云计算技术的虚拟服务器,通过虚拟化技术将物理服务器资源进行划分,提供给用户按需使用。与传统的物理服务器不同,云服务器具有灵活、高效、可扩展的优势,用户只需按需支付,不用担心硬件维护和更新问题。因此,云服务器已成为当前搭建网站的首选平台。
为什么选择云服务器搭建网站?
高可用性与稳定性
云服务器通过多台服务器的协作,保证了网站在面对高流量访问时依然能够稳定运行。即使某台服务器发生故障,云平台会自动切换到其他健康服务器,确保网站的高可用性。
弹性扩展性
随着网站流量的增长,云服务器能够根据实际需求进行资源扩展。无论是增加带宽、存储还是处理能力,都可以迅速完成,保证网站性能不受影响。传统服务器往往需要提前购买大量硬件,而云服务器则能节省不必要的开支。
成本优势
云服务器采取按需计费的方式,用户根据使用的资源量来支付费用,而不像传统服务器那样需要一次性购买大量硬件设备。这种模式不仅减少了初期投入,还能根据实际需求灵活调整费用,降低了运营成本。
全球部署与快速访问
大多数云服务商在全球多个地区都有数据中心,用户可以根据目标用户群体的地理位置选择合适的数据中心。这不仅能提升网站的访问速度,还能确保不同地区的用户都能享受到流畅的浏览体验。
如何通过云服务器搭建网站?
选择云服务商
目前,国内外有很多云服务商提供网站搭建所需的云服务器资源,如阿里云、腾讯云、华为云、AWS、GoogleCloud等。在选择云服务商时,可以根据自己的预算、技术需求以及服务支持来做出决策。例如,如果你是一家初创企业或个人博客,可能选择价格较为亲民的云服务商;而对于需要全球部署和高性能支持的企业来说,AWS或GoogleCloud等可能更合适。
选择合适的操作系统
云服务器搭建网站时,操作系统的选择至关重要。大多数云服务商提供Windows和Linux两种操作系统,Linux因其稳定性、安全性以及开源的特点,成为开发者和企业用户的首选。对于网站搭建初学者,可以选择常见的操作系统,如CentOS、Ubuntu等,它们有着完善的社区支持,帮助用户更快上手。
安装Web服务器
云服务器部署网站的关键步骤是安装Web服务器。最常用的Web服务器软件有Apache和Nginx,二者各有特点。Apache稳定性强,适合处理大量静态文件请求,而Nginx则因其高效、低资源消耗而广受欢迎,尤其适合高并发场景。根据自己网站的需求,选择合适的Web服务器并进行安装配置,是搭建网站的第一步。
配置数据库
网站数据的存储与管理离不开数据库,常见的数据库有MySQL、PostgreSQL等。根据网站功能的复杂度,选择合适的数据库并进行安装和配置。在配置数据库时,除了保证数据的安全性外,还需要考虑数据库的性能和扩展性,以应对未来可能的流量增长。
网站的开发与设计
网站搭建的最后一步是开发和设计网站。无论是选择自定义开发,还是使用建站平台,云服务器为网站的开发提供了强大的支持。通过将网站文件上传至云服务器,你就能够将自己的创意与设计转化为一个可以在线访问的网站。
通过云服务器搭建网站的过程是一个全面的数字化转型的开始。以下,我们继续为您提供更多的搭建技巧和后期运维经验,帮助您进一步提升网站的质量和性能。
1.网站的内容管理
随着网站的逐步搭建,内容管理将成为一个重要任务。为了便于管理和更新内容,许多网站选择使用内容管理系统(CMS)。常见的CMS如WordPress、Joomla、Drupal等,都可以通过云服务器轻松部署。通过这些系统,用户不仅可以方便地更新文章、图片和产品信息,还能够通过插件和主题来扩展功能和优化外观。云服务器的高可用性确保了这些CMS能够在不同的访问量下平稳运行。
2.网站的安全性
网站安全是一个常被忽视但至关重要的方面。随着黑客攻击、数据泄露事件频繁发生,保障网站的安全性显得尤为重要。云服务器提供了一系列的安全防护措施,包括防火墙、DDoS防护、SSL证书等,可以有效抵御外部攻击,保护用户数据的安全。定期的安全更新和漏洞修复,也是保持网站安全的有效手段。
配置防火墙
大多数云服务商都会提供基于云的防火墙功能,能够对网站流量进行监控和过滤。配置防火墙可以有效阻止不良访问,避免恶意攻击和非授权访问。通过设置访问控制列表(ACL),你还可以指定哪些IP地址或地区能够访问你的服务器,从而提高网站的安全性。
SSL证书的配置
SSL证书能够加密网站和用户之间的通信,确保数据传输过程中的安全性。安装SSL证书后,网站将启用HTTPS协议,提升用户的信任度,并且在搜索引擎排名中也会得到更好的支持。因此,为了提升网站的安全性和信誉,安装并配置SSL证书是不可忽视的一步。
3.网站的优化与SEO
网站的上线并不意味着一切就完成了。为了吸引更多的访问者,SEO(搜索引擎优化)是一个持续优化的过程。通过合理的SEO策略,能够提升网站在搜索引擎中的排名,吸引更多流量。云服务器提供的稳定性能和高速度,可以确保在进行SEO优化时,网站能够快速响应,提升用户体验。
提升网站速度
网站速度直接影响到用户的体验和搜索引擎的排名。云服务器通常能够提供高效的资源利用率,确保网站在高流量下仍能流畅运行。通过CDN(内容分发网络)加速,可以让全球用户都能够享受更快的访问速度。
优化网站结构
合理的网站结构可以让搜索引擎更容易抓取网站内容,提高搜索排名。因此,在网站搭建初期,就应考虑到页面的布局、URL结构以及内部链接的设置。使用清晰、简洁的目录结构和页面命名规则,有助于提升SEO效果。
4.持续监控与优化
网站搭建完成后,并不意味着一切就结束了。为了保证网站能够持续稳定运行,定期的监控与优化是非常重要的。通过使用云服务器提供的监控工具,可以实时跟踪网站的流量、访问来源、性能指标等,为后期的优化提供数据支持。结合用户反馈,不断进行内容更新与功能改进,使网站在激烈的市场竞争中始终保持优势。
总结
通过云服务器搭建网站不仅能够提高建设效率,还能通过灵活的资源管理、稳定的性能保障和低成本的运营模式,帮助个人和企业轻松迈入数字化时代。随着互联网的发展,云服务器无疑是网站建设和运营的最佳选择。无论是企业官网、个人博客还是电商平台,云服务器都能为你提供强大而高效的支持,助你在竞争激烈的市场中脱颖而出。





